Definitions

  1. v. t. To overspread, as with a fluid or tincture; to fill or cover, as with something fluid; as, eyes suffused with tears; cheeks suffused with blushes.
  2. v. cause to spread or flush or flood through, over, or across
  3. v. to become overspread as with a fluid, a colour, a gleam of light
  4. To overspread, as with a fluid or tincture; to fill or cover, as with something fluid; as, eyes suffused with tears; cheeks suffused with blushes. When purple light shall next suffuse the skies. Pope.
